Transaction 8ce66a180bb29a27ce6f3004d984c6fe243fd1f723ac781b138fee94efbeb164
1 Input
1 Output
-
8ce66a180bb29a27ce6f3004d984c6fe243fd1f723ac781b138fee94efbeb164:0
- value
- 58417200
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4415ea32aa9a92c209625af68bb1319e025da3f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17D1CiQhR2fENBp5uAa8WkdzfRoEUX1WqG